Streszczenie: This study examined the possibility to form liposomal compositions containing PKH-26 fluorescent dye and to use those compositions in order to assess absorption and tissue distribution of the liposomes in rat liver. Liposomal compositions consisted of egg lecithin and cholesterol (Sigma) in a 7:5 ratio, respectively. The dye was incorporated into the lipid layer while preparing multilamellar vesicles with the extruder. The obtained labeled liposomal compositions allowed to quantitatively assess how the vesicles are absorbed by the liver and visualize the dye distribution in different liver cells. The study presents the data on the absorption and distribution of the dye in the liver, according to the size of the lipid vesicles, 1, 2 and 24 hours after the intravenous administartion.
